Understanding File System Structures in Operating Systems

Explore the various file system structures commonly found in operating systems, with a focus on the hierarchical approach. Learn how organizing files in directories enhances data management and simplifies navigation, while comparing other structures like relational databases and flat files. Discover the best ways to manage your data effectively.

Navigating File Systems: The Hierarchical Structure Explained

Ah, file systems—those invisible architectures that keep our digital lives organized, lest we drown in a sea of disarray. Whether you’re a tech novice or a seasoned pro, understanding how these systems work is essential for anyone involved with computer applications and information technology. So, let’s unravel this topic with a focus on something many may take for granted: the hierarchical file structure.

What’s the Deal with File Systems?

You might be wondering, what exactly is a file system? Think of it as a librarian organizing a library. Just as books need proper categorization—like genres or authors—your computer files require a systematic way to store and retrieve them. The beauty of a well-structured filing system lies not just in its functionality but in its ability to help us find what we need without pulling our hair out in frustration.

Hierarchical Structure: The Tree of Knowledge

When it comes to file systems, the hierarchical structure reigns supreme. This model resembles a tree—with folders, subdirectories, and files branching out like a robust oak. Imagine opening your computer and seeing a “Documents” folder. Within it, there might be subfolders for various projects or categories. Inside those, you'll find individual files. This tree-like organization gives you a clear path to follow, making it easier to manage large amounts of information.

For instance, think about a project you’re working on for school or your job. You might have a main folder dedicated to the project, containing subfolders for research, drafts, and references. Each subfolder then holds specific files. This arrangement not only keeps things tidy but also makes it a breeze to locate what you’re looking for—especially in a world where digital clutter can quickly accumulate. You wouldn't want to spend more time searching for your files than actually working on them, would you?

Other Structures: Worth a Mention

Now, let’s take a quick detour to touch on some other file system structures; after all, knowledge is power!

  1. Relational Database: This structure is like a sophisticated town planner, organizing data in tables that communicate with each other through defined relationships. It’s fantastic for managing complex queries and conducting extensive data analysis, but it’s not the best fit for simple file organization tasks.

  2. Networked Structure: This approach is often used in file systems that involve shared access across networks. While it allows files to be reached from various computer systems, it doesn’t prioritize a hierarchical organization. Think of it as a communal library where everyone can access all sections—useful but potentially chaotic without some kind of organization!

  3. Flat File Structure: Picture a single-layered stack of papers—everything is crammed in there without any folders or divisions. While this makes for quick access to individual files, it becomes a headache when you have dozens, or even hundreds, of files scattered about. The lack of organization can make finding specific items feel like searching for a needle in a haystack.

By understanding these alternative structures, you gain a more rounded perspective. However, when your goal is efficient organization, the hierarchical structure is the way to go.

The Benefits of Hierarchical Organization

So, why are you likely to encounter the hierarchical file structure in most operating systems? Here’s the scoop:

  1. Clear Organization: It’s efficient! You can break down complex sets of data into manageable pieces. Instead of scrolling through one endless list, you navigate through folders, similar to flipping through a well-organized filing cabinet.

  2. Ease of Navigation: You ever find yourself getting lost in your own files? The nested nature of a hierarchical structure helps maintain context and reduces that "Where is it again?" feeling we often face.

  3. Categorization: It mirrors the way we think about information. Just as you might categorize your physical files, the hierarchical structure aligns with human cognitive patterns. You might have a category for “Personal” and another for “Work,” helping you compartmentalize effortlessly.

Keeping It Fresh: Tips to Maintain Your Hierarchical Structure

Now that we’ve established the pros, let’s sprinkle in a couple of tips on keeping your file system as organized as a Library of Congress!

  • Consistent Naming Conventions: Use clear, descriptive names for your folders and files. This makes it easier to find what you’re looking for at a glance. Avoid cryptic abbreviations; future you will thank you!

  • Regular Clean-up: Just like decluttering your physical space, make it a habit to revisit your files. Delete or archive anything you no longer need—it keeps your hierarchy lean and mean.

  • Strategic Subfolder Creation: Don’t just throw everything into one main folder. Strategically create subfolders based on themes, projects, or individual tasks you work on.

  • Use Tags and Shortcuts: If your operating system supports it, utilize tags or shortcut links to your most-used folders and files. It’s a nifty way to bridge the gaps between your main folders and crucial content.

Final Thoughts: Embracing the Hierarchical Way

To wrap things up, let’s hold onto this nugget of wisdom: an organized file system is a stress-free file system. The hierarchical structure offers clarity and efficiency, allowing you to focus on what really matters, like completing that crucial project or just winding down with a good movie at the end of a long day.

Understanding and applying this organizational strategy in your digital life could very well alleviate some of that everyday tech frustration! So, next time you sit down at your computer, give a nod to the fascinating world of file systems and maybe even restructure how you categorize your files. Who knows, you might just rediscover the joy of digital order!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y